The Benefits of a Partial Hospitalization Program for Addiction

A Partial Hospitalization Program (PHP) plays a key role in addiction treatment. It’s a good fit for people who have finished medical detox or inpatient rehab, or who need strong clinical support with flexibility to manage their daily responsibilities. PHP provides structured care to help people make real, lasting progress in their recovery.

Intensive Support Without Full Hospitalization: PHP typically runs five to seven days a week during daytime hours. Patients visit the facility to participate in therapy for four to eight hours, then go home. This allows them to stay connected to their home and community.

Consistent Clinical Check-Ins: Our team of clinical and support professionals check in with patients regularly throughout the program. This ensures that medications, therapy, and treatment plans are always working in each patient’s best interest.

A Structured Path to Independence: PHP helps patients begin practicing recovery in everyday life. Each evening at home is a chance to use the coping skills built during the day, strengthening the habits and self-trust that lasting sobriety requires.

Seamless Continuity of Care: PHP is a natural next step for patients leaving inpatient care, and a strong starting point for those who need more structured support. Either way, it keeps recovery moving forward at a critical time.

What to Expect in a PHP for Substance Use Disorder

Milton Jefferson Recovery’s PHP is built around structure, support, and a clear path forward. The patient experience at Milton Jefferson Recovery will include:

Comprehensive Intake Evaluation

Every patient starts with a thorough assessment. Our clinical team takes the time to understand each person’s history with substance use, any co-occurring mental health conditions, personal goals, and current challenges. Treatment plans are built around the individual because no two people’s needs are the same.

A Balanced Therapy Schedule

Every day may include a mix of individual therapy, group therapy, educational workshops, skill-building activities, and holistic programming. This structure creates routine and accountability, giving patients a healthy framework while maintaining space for life to happen.

Skill Development & Relapse Prevention

Throughout the program, patients develop practical skills. These include healthy ways to handle stress, tools for rebuilding relationships, and strategies for recognizing and responding to relapse warning signs early.

Transition Planning

As patients naturally progress out of PHP, our team works with them to plan the next step, like moving to an Intensive Outpatient Program. Patients move forward with a clear plan, continued access to therapy and medication support, as well as the community they built during treatment. Evidence-Based Therapies Used in Our Partial Hospitalization Program

At Milton Jefferson Recovery, strong clinical care and genuine human connection go hand in hand. Our partial hospitalization program for substance use brings together a team of care providers, all focused on each patient’s personal treatment plan. The therapies we use are grounded in research and chosen to support meaningful change, including:

  •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T): CBT helps patients recognize and change the thoughts and behaviors that fuel substance use. Patients learn practical tools for managing stress, cravings, and other triggers they may face in daily life.
  •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T): DBT gives patients concrete skills for managing intense emotions. It is especially helpful for individuals who experience emotional highs and lows that can make recovery harder to sustain.
  • Motivational Interviewing (MI): MI is a collaborative, conversation-based approach that helps patients explore their own reasons for change. It builds internal motivation and strengthens commitment to recovery at a pace that feels right for each individual.
  • Schema Therapy: Schema therapy helps patients identify deep-rooted patterns of thinking and behavior that may have developed early in life and contributed to substance use.
  • Group Therapy: In group sessions, patients connect with others who understand what recovery feels like from the inside. With a therapist leading the way, patients build communication skills and find support in shared experience.
  • Psychoeducation: Learning about addiction is a key part of recovery. Psychoeducation covers topics like how addiction works, how to prevent relapse, and how to spot early warning signs before old patterns take hold.
